Lloyds Engineering Works Stake Diluted in Defence Subsidiary Following Equity Private Placement​

Lloyds Enterprises Limited has seen a change in the ownership structure of its material subsidiary, Lloyds Advance Defence Systems Limited (LADSL), following the approval and allotment of an equity private placement.

The transaction resulted in a dilution of shares held by Lloyds Engineering Works Limited (LEWL) in LADSL. This corporate action transitioned LADSL from being a wholly-owned subsidiary of LLoyds Enterprises Limited to a subsidiary holding 85% stake controlled by LEWL.

LADSL approved the private placement of equity shares at its Extraordinary General Meeting held on June 24, 2026. Subsequently, the Board of Directors of LADSL met on June 29, 2026, and approved the allotment of these new equity shares to the holding company and two other investors. The consideration for this private placement was specified as cash consideration.

Impact of Private Placement​

The private placement affected the shareholding of Lloyds Engineering Works Limited in LADSL. As a result of the transaction, LEWL’s original stake was diluted by 15%. Post-allotment, Lloyds Engineering Works Limited now holds an 85% share in Lloyds Advance Defence Systems Limited.
